Bacon Mac and Cheese

Introduction

When I think of comfort food, the first thing that comes to mind is a rich, cheesy bowl of mac and cheese. But, of course, if you want to make it even better, you add crispy bacon. I mean, why not, right? Bacon takes everything to the next level, and when combined with creamy cheese and perfectly cooked pasta, it’s nothing short of magic.

I first made this dish on a lazy Sunday, looking for something warm and indulgent to enjoy while watching my favorite show. I threw together some ingredients I had on hand, and to my surprise, it turned out amazing. Since then, it’s become a family favorite—whether as a side dish or a main course. The crispy bacon provides a salty, smoky crunch that complements the gooey cheese sauce, making each bite unforgettable.

Why You’ll Love This Recipe:

  • Versatile
    This dish is perfect for any occasion. Whether you’re serving it at a cozy family dinner or as a potluck contribution, it’s always a hit.

  • Budget-Friendly
    Mac and cheese is an affordable dish to make, and adding bacon is a cost-effective way to elevate the flavors without breaking the bank.


Ingredients for the Recipe

  • 8 oz elbow macaroni or pasta of choice

  • 6 slices of turkey bacon (or regular bacon)

  • 2 cups shredded sharp cheddar cheese

  • 1 cup shredded mozzarella cheese

  • 2 tablespoons butter

  • 2 tablespoons all-purpose flour

  • 2 cups milk (whole or 2%)

  • 1 teaspoon garlic powder

  • ½ teaspoon salt (or to taste)

  • ¼ teaspoon black pepper

  • ¼ teaspoon paprika (optional)

  • Fresh parsley for garnish (optional)

How to Make This Recipe

Step-by-Step Instructions

  1. Cook the Pasta
    Start by boiling a large pot of water. Once it’s boiling, add a pinch of salt and the elbow macaroni (or pasta of your choice). Cook according to the package instructions until al dente. This usually takes around 8 minutes. Once done, drain the pasta and set it aside. You’ll want it ready for the cheesy sauce.

  2. Cook the Bacon
    In a large skillet, cook the turkey bacon over medium heat until crispy. This will take about 5–7 minutes, depending on the thickness of the bacon. Once cooked, transfer the bacon to a paper towel-lined plate to drain excess fat. Once cooled, chop the bacon into small pieces. Set aside.

  3. Make the Cheese Sauce
    In the same skillet, melt 2 tablespoons of butter over medium heat. Once melted, sprinkle in 2 tablespoons of flour. Whisk constantly to create a roux, which will thicken your cheese sauce. Continue whisking for about 1–2 minutes until it forms a smooth paste and turns a light golden color.

  4. Add Milk and Seasonings
    Slowly pour in 2 cups of milk while continuing to whisk. This helps to avoid any lumps in the sauce. Add 1 teaspoon of garlic powder, ½ teaspoon of salt, ¼ teaspoon of black pepper, and ¼ teaspoon of paprika (if using). Bring the mixture to a gentle simmer. Keep stirring until the sauce thickens, which should take around 3–4 minutes.

  5. Melt the Cheese
    Once your sauce has thickened, reduce the heat to low and add in 2 cups of shredded sharp cheddar cheese and 1 cup of shredded mozzarella cheese. Stir until the cheese is completely melted and the sauce becomes creamy and smooth. Taste and adjust the seasoning if needed.

  6. Combine Pasta and Cheese Sauce
    Add the drained pasta to the skillet with the cheese sauce. Stir gently to coat the pasta evenly in the cheesy goodness. Make sure each noodle is covered in the creamy sauce.

  7. Add Bacon
    Finally, stir in the chopped bacon, saving a little for garnish if you like. The crispy bacon adds a wonderful crunch and smoky flavor to the creamy mac and cheese.

  8. Serve and Garnish
    Once everything is combined, transfer your bacon mac and cheese to serving bowls. If desired, garnish with a sprinkle of fresh parsley and the remaining crispy bacon pieces. You can also add an extra sprinkle of cheese on top for a cheesy finish.

Quick and Easy

This bacon mac and cheese recipe is surprisingly quick for how indulgent it is. With just a few simple steps, you can have a rich, cheesy dish ready in under 30 minutes. The stovetop method keeps things fast, so you won’t need to bake it in the oven unless you want an extra crispy top.

The best part? You can easily double or triple this recipe for a crowd or leftovers. It’s one of those dishes that only gets better the next day when the flavors have had time to meld.

Customizable

This recipe is highly customizable based on your preferences or what you have in your pantry. If you’re feeling adventurous, you can swap out the cheeses for your favorites. Gouda, Parmesan, or pepper jack would all make great additions. You can even add a bit of cream cheese to the sauce for an extra rich texture.

If you’re looking for a lighter version, you can use low-fat milk and reduce the amount of butter. You could also substitute the turkey bacon for a vegetarian option like tempeh or skip the bacon altogether for a vegetarian dish.

Want to spice it up? Add a few dashes of hot sauce or a sprinkle of cayenne pepper to the sauce for a kick. For an even more hearty dish, throw in some cooked chicken or veggies like spinach or mushrooms.

Perfect for Guests

This bacon mac and cheese is the ultimate crowd-pleaser. It’s hearty, flavorful, and guaranteed to be a hit at any dinner party or potluck. You can easily serve it as a main dish or as a side to complement other hearty foods like grilled chicken or roasted vegetables.

It’s an especially great option for casual get-togethers, since it can be made ahead of time and reheated when guests arrive. Just be sure to save some extra bacon to top it off before serving for that extra wow factor.

FAQs (Frequently Asked Questions)

Can I use regular bacon instead of turkey bacon?
Yes, you can absolutely use regular bacon if you prefer. Just cook it until it’s crispy, and then chop it into small pieces to mix into the mac and cheese. The regular bacon will add a richer, smokier flavor.

Can I make this recipe ahead of time?
Definitely! You can prepare the mac and cheese in advance and refrigerate it for up to 2 days. When ready to serve, simply reheat it on the stove over low heat, adding a splash of milk if needed to loosen the sauce. If you want a crispy top, you can even bake it for 10–15 minutes at 350°F (175°C).

Can I use gluten-free pasta?
Yes, you can substitute gluten-free pasta in this recipe without any issue. There are many great gluten-free pasta options available, such as rice or corn-based pasta, that will work perfectly in this dish.

What can I substitute for the mozzarella cheese?
If you don’t have mozzarella on hand, you can substitute it with any mild, meltable cheese such as Monterey Jack or Gouda. These will melt beautifully into the sauce and add a smooth, creamy texture.

How can I make the mac and cheese spicier?
For an extra spicy kick, you can add some diced jalapeños to the cheese sauce, or stir in some cayenne pepper or hot sauce. Adjust the spice level to your preference!

Leave a Comment